IEEE Journal of Electromagnetics RF and Microwaves in Medicine and Biology is an international academic journal dedicated to the application of electromagnetics, radio frequency signals, and microwave/millimeter waves in the fields of medicine and biology. The research published in this journal covers new methods of these technologies in preclinical and clinical applications, emphasizing the important features of biological research and practical aspects of medical applications. The magazine aims to promote interdisciplinary research and advance innovation and applications of electromagnetic technology in medical imaging, treatment, and diagnosis.

CiteScore 是由Elsevier(爱思唯尔)推出的另一种评价期刊影响力的文献计量指标。反映出一家期刊近期发表论文的年篇均引用次数。CiteScore以Scopus数据库中收集的引文为基础,针对的是前四年发表的论文的引文。CiteScore的意义在于,它可以为学术界提供一种新的、更全面、更客观地评价期刊影响力的方法,而不仅仅是通过影响因子(IF)这一单一指标来评价。

JCR分区的优势在于它可以帮助读者对学术文献质量进行评估。不同学科的文章引用量可能存在较大的差异,此时单独依靠影响因子(IF)评价期刊的质量可能是存在一定问题的。因此,JCR将期刊按照学科门类和影响因子分为不同的分区,这样读者可以根据自己的研究领域和需求选择合适的期刊。
